Serbian company to help NAIP attract Balkan investment in Belarus

MINSK, 2 August (BelTA) – The National Agency of Investment and Privatization (NAIP) and Serbia’s UIN have signed an agreement on cooperation in the attraction of foreign direct investment from the Balkan region in Belarus, BelTA learned from the press service of the Economy Ministry of Belarus.

The parties agreed to exchange information free of charge, cooperate in searching for potential investors, consult them and together organize necessary meetings and negotiations. The Serbian company intends to conduct such activities in Serbia, Croatia,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Montenegro and North Macedonia.

“The willingness of the Serbian partners to share their business experience in our country can be explained by the positive history: several years ago UIN launched a business incubator of the same name in Pukhovichi District, Minsk Oblast with a focus on social and educational projects,” the press service noted.

The National Agency of Investment and Privatization introduced the practice of such partnership non-commercial agreements in 2020. The same agreements are currently in place with two other partners, a Belarusian company with Japanese capital and a European company which sphere of activity is connected with Austria, Germany, Italy, and Switzerland.
